Duke University: 1,725 sponsored US clinical trials, 187 recruiting.

Duke University sponsors 1,725 registered US clinical trials on ClinicalTrials.gov, 187 of them currently recruiting, and 1,244 completed. 175 of these trials are in Phase 3-4 (later-stage) and 311 in Phase 1-2 (earlier-stage). The most-studied condition in this pipeline is Obesity, with 15 trials.

Trial completion reliability score

D 55/100

1,244 of 1,444 decided trials (Completed vs. Terminated on ClinicalTrials.gov) reached their planned completion (86.1%), vs. national p10 68.4% / p90 100% among 1,234 sponsors with at least 10 decided trials. Still-open trials (Recruiting, Active-not-recruiting, Not-yet-recruiting) are excluded since they have not reached an outcome yet.
